How they compare
Germany currently reports 96.3% against 96.0% in Romania, a difference of 0.3%.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 10 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Germany ahead.
Germany ranks 60th and Romania ranks 62nd of 164 countries.
Germany has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Germany | Romania |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 99.4% | 96.4% | 3.1% | Germany |
| 2000s | 98.5% | 95.3% | 3.2% | Germany |
| 2010s | 97.0% | 95.0% | 1.9% | Germany |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Persistence to last grade of primary is the percentage of children enrolled in the first grade of primary school who eventually reach the last grade of primary education. The estimate is based on the reconstructed cohort method.
